Charitable Projects
Our projects over the year include donations to the following charities: -
Operation Smile – a charity that performs medical surgery to correct palate deformities in children. Staff participated in Run.
The Dettol Heart Run - whose objective is to perform free heart surgery for disadvantaged children and young adults
Safaricom Challenge/Lewa Foundation – a charity Run to raise money for building Schools for the Lewa Community in Laikipia District, Kenya.
The ‘Flying Toilets’ project to build pit latrines in one of the city slums.
Donations to the Moot Club of the Law Faculty at Moi Eldoret University to support training of advocacy.
Safaricom Charity Auction– we purchased and sold a pedigree bull to raise money for a Thika School for destitute children.
Contributions to The National Famine Relief Fund.
The Firm established and supports Junior Achievement Kenya.
Supporting the Nairobi Women's Hospital Gender Violence Recovery Centre.
Due to restrictions on publicity for the legal profession, these donations are not publicised in the media.
Pro Bono Work
Our lawyers do a considerable amount of pro bono work for indigent individuals and charities.
We have established a number of charitable and other foundations without any charge for legal fees. The Firm advises and assists a number of charities in the furtherance of their objects, such as Junior Achievements Kenya Limited referred to above.
Our Employees
We have a comprehensive medical policy and a capacity building program for our staff. Recognising the prevalence and devastating effects of AIDS, we actively assist in helping HIV positive employees obtain the necessary anti-retroviral medication and so as to enable them to continue being productive members of society and most importantly to continue supporting their families.
We also have a football team that includes staff from all sectors of the Firm and participates in inter-firm matches.
